How Much Will You Really Spend on Teeth Whitening?

Determining your true cost for teeth bleaching can be somewhat tricky. A number of factors influence the final amount. At first , readily available brightening strips might seem to be the cheap choice , frequently costing around $20 to $100. But, dentist-supervised teeth brightening procedures are considerably more expensive , typically beginning at $300 and possibly going up to $1,000, depending on a number of appointments and the specific type of bleaching formula used . Avoid forget extra costs , like assessments and take-home trays , which increase your total price .

{Teeth Whitening: Fees, Methods & What to Foresee

Want a whiter smile? Tooth whitening is a common cosmetic procedure , but understanding the costs , techniques, and what to experience is crucial . In-office whitening typically prices anywhere from $500 to $ 1,000 or even higher depending on the practice , the extent of yellowing, and the chosen approach . Options include at-home trays, which typically cost between $ 75 and $ 400, and faster in-office sessions that may involve advanced gels . Throughout the process , you might feel temporary discomfort which often addressed with desensitizing products . After any whitening method, it's vital to avoid strongly colored drinks like red wine to maintain the brightness .

Whitening Your Smile: Whitening Strips vs. Expert Options

Want a whiter smile? You've got probably seen whitening the teeth. Available teeth whitening strips offer a easy and relatively inexpensive option, but their results are usually more subtle. Professional whitening treatments, administered in a dental professional, involve more powerful bleaching agents and typically deliver much dramatic and permanent outcomes. Ultimately, the best method relies on your budget, the whitening and dental condition.
